Vorige week kwam ik met een recensie van 2X ThinClientOS, een Linux-distributie gespecialiseerd voor thin clients. U bevindt zich echter mogelijk aan de andere kant van het probleem: u wilt een eigen thin client-server hebben. De eenvoudigste manier om dat te doen is om LTSP te gebruiken. Het staat voor "Linux Terminal Server Project" en maakt van elke computer die met internet is verbonden, in feite een server waaraan thin clients kunnen worden gekoppeld. Om het nog eenvoudiger te maken, kan LTSP worden geïnstalleerd op elke gewone Linux-distributie zoals openSUSE, Fedora, Debian en natuurlijk Ubuntu. Er zijn twee manieren om LTSP op Ubuntu te installeren: vanaf het begin of vanaf de bovenkant van een reeds bestaand systeem. Ik zal me meer op het eerste concentreren, maar het laatste is ook eenvoudig en ik zal het kort bespreken.

Installeren vanuit Scratch

Eerst heeft u een Ubuntu Alternate CD nodig. Voor dit voorbeeld heb ik vanaf hier een klassieke 10.04 i386 ISO genomen. In het geval dat je het niet weet, is een alternatieve CD vergelijkbaar met de gewone, maar zonder de mooie interface voor het installeren van Ubuntu en krijg je toegang tot meer opties. Hiertoe behoort de mogelijkheid om tijdens het opstarten op F4 te drukken om "Installeer een LTSP-server" uit de verschillende modi te selecteren.

De installatie zal dan zoals gewoonlijk worden uitgevoerd wanneer een alternatieve CD wordt gebruikt:

  • Selecteer je taal
  • Kies je land
  • Selecteer uw toetsenbordindeling (automatisch of handmatig)
  • De DHCP configureert zichzelf
  • Kies een hostnaam

  • Stel de klok in
  • Selecteer uw partitiesysteem (volledige schijf, gedeeltelijk, versleuteld, etc.)

  • De installatie zal beginnen. Het kan een paar minuten duren
  • Kies zoals gewoonlijk een gebruikersnaam en een wachtwoord

  • Bepaal of u uw / home wilt versleutelen
  • De afbeelding wordt gecomprimeerd

  • En tot slot zal de GRUB bootloader worden geïnstalleerd

En dat is het. U kunt nu opnieuw opstarten en uw eerste thin client verbinden.

Merk op dat zelfs als het automatische installatieprogramma geweldig is, in sommige gevallen sommige handmatige configuratie nodig kan zijn.

Ik raad u aan om te kijken naar "/etc/ltsp/dhcpd.conf" en "/opt/ltsp/i386/lts.conf" voor de geavanceerde instellingen. De LTSP Wiki is zeer informatief.

Als u uw computer wilt transformeren naar een thin client-server zonder alles opnieuw te moeten installeren, kan LTSP dat ook. Installeer gewoon de vereiste pakketten:

 sudo apt-get installeer ltsp-server-standalone openssh-server 

En start vervolgens het automatische configuratieproces via

 sudo ltsp-build-client 

Het kost wat tijd om alles op te halen en te installeren.

Het lukte me de eerste keer niet, maar dit kwam waarschijnlijk door de slechte internetverbinding, dus aarzel niet om het opnieuw te proberen in geval van een storing. Houd er echter rekening mee dat hier meestal enige handmatige configuratie nodig is. Je kunt eindelijk je server starten met

 sudo /etc/init.d/dhcp3-server start 

Conclusie

Zoals ik al eerder zei, kan LTSP worden geïnstalleerd op een overvloed aan andere distributies, dus je kunt zelf kiezen als je wilt. Ubuntu kan worden beschouwd als de standaard voor een zelfstudie, maar de wiki van elke distributie is heel precies en veel gedetailleerder. Als laatste advies moet je controleren of je thin clients kunnen worden opgestart van het netwerk, want het is echt vervelend om het handmatig te doen als je er meer dan tien hebt.

Zou je een andere distributie kiezen om LTSP op te installeren? Of zou u in de eerste plaats iets anders dan LTSP kiezen? Laat ons je mening weten in de comments.